On Saturday, May 10, former Shoreham-Wading River High School standout Elizabeth Sabino’s current collegiate team the St. Thomas Aquinas Spartans lost 2-6 against the Pace Setters in the NCAA Division II Softball Championship.

The game took place at Pace Softball Field at 11 a.m. and was the first matchup against the Pace Setters in the tournament.

The St. Thomas Aquinas Spartans’ next game will take place on Saturday, May 10 at 4 p.m. at Pace Softball Field.
